WebSockets

> Real-time connections are long-lived and trusted-by-default — close that gap. Principles are firm; the numbers are examples.

  1. Authenticate on the connection event, not on first message. Unauthenticated → disconnect() immediately; an open unauthenticated socket is an info leak + resource drain.
  2. Authorize every room join before join() — never let clients join arbitrary rooms by name.
  3. Reconnect with bounded exponential backoff (e.g. 1s→2s→4s, 3 tries) — immediate loops cause a thundering herd on outage. After max retries, show an explicit offline state; never retry forever.
  4. Event names live in a shared enum, never raw strings — renames break at compile time instead of silently.
  5. Version the event schema — an incompatible client must detect and stop, not misinterpret events.
